The Services Engineer, will be responsible for carrying out installations, maintenance and repairs Bio-A products for delivering the desired customer service experience. The goal is to drive service success that improves customer satisfaction, maximizes customer retention and increases profitability
Main Responsibilities & Tasks:
Provide exceptional customer care
Provide technical support to customers
Travel to customers by ground, train and air transportation as needed
Provide training to customers on the basic use and operation of Bio Analytics instruments
Perform break fix service, and installation of complex mechanical systems
Perform preventative maintenance
Perform software updates / upgrades

Assist with resolving IT issues related to Bio Analytics system installations
Assist in drafting documentation of process and procedure as required
Pass along identified leads to the sales manager
Travel to our Ann Arbor, MI, Freemont, CA and or Welwyn Garden City, UK facilities for training as needed
Lift items that weigh up to 35 Kg
Qualifications & Skills:
Excellent customer skills
Mechanical or Biomedical Engineering Technology degree
Good IT skills
Willingness to travel extensively on short notice
Excellent mechanical / electromechanical skills
Good oral and written English
3+ years life science related field service experience
Be familiar with Microsoft office / CRM tools
